Dear 6th yr Parents, We have been made aware of the following Free Counselling available until March 31st which may be of interest - MyMind has been supported via Sláintecare & the HSE to provide FREE counselling online and by phone to individuals aged 18 years+ until 31st March 2021. The FREE counselling is available to individuals aged 18 years+ to whom any one of the criteria below applies: · Presenting with COVID-19 related mental health issues (e.g. bereavement, social isolation/cocooning, illness, stress, depression, anxiety, addiction, domestic violence) · A front-line worker in a medical setting (e.g. HSE staff, nursing home staff, paramedic, public health worker, GP) · Employed with low income (see threshold in How Do I Apply section on MyMind.org ) · Unemployed due to COVID 19 · Bereaved resulting from COVID 19 · Over the age of 65 · Cocooning due to ill-health (regardless of age) To arrange an appointment and for further information please contact MyMind directly by email hq@mymind.org, by calling 076 680 1060, or by visiting MyMind.org

The Houses of the Oireachtas Transition Year work experience programme
Created : 20 Jan 2021, 1:09 PM
Archived : 20 Mar 2021, 12:00 AM
There is an opportunity for any TY student interested in how the Houses of the Oireachtas operate. There will be two intake cohorts: one commencing on Monday 8th March through English and another commencing Monday the 15th March through Irish. We propose to accept 20 students in each cohort. There will be a maximum of one student accepted from each school. See attached pdf document for further details Closing date for applications is : February 4th 2021. One student from Scoil Mhuire will be chosen to apply for the position using the same application. Any questions email: aedamarnolan@scoilmhuireclane.ie
